We enjoyed an exellent tour of the brewery today. It was a Christmas present from my daughter. Becky was our tour guide today, she was very knowledgeable explaining every aspect of the brewing process as we moved around. Our group of eighteen was invited to taste some dried hops in their various stages and any questions were easily answered by out host. It was great to see the sign painting section and of course we were all taken with the size of the magnificent Shire horses still being used to deliver beer locally. Then we came to the beer tasting. We were given a generous sample of each beer available. We tasted seven different beers in all, my own personal favourite being the "Old timer" we also enjoyed a very tasty hot pie in the cosy little bar at extra cost. I can highly recommend this tour of the brewery which took a little over two hours. At no time were we rushed to get around. There is also a shop selling lots of merchandise. An amazing experience, I'm tempted to go again.

Awesome place with loads of history (and beer of course!) The guides are very knowledgeable and the tour last about 2 hours. You get to tour the entire Victorian and new side of the brewery, as well as the sign making studio and the horses! The tasting was great too - sample of 7 different beers! Definitely worth a visit!
